// REINDEX_BATCH_CAP limits docs per shard pass in the Tallowfield
// nightly search reindex. Raising it starves the ingest queue;
// lowering it overruns the maintenance window. 5000 is the tested
// sweet spot. Change only with a soak run. Verified against the
// build noted below.

session token of bawif-hahog = htk6_ac5981

## Auth

LiftSim's dispatch API won't talk to you without a token, full stop. Grab one from the sandbox console under your Vertiq dev account — they last 12 hours, so don't hardcode them in tests (looking at you, past me). Pass it in the Authorization header on every call. For review purposes, use the shared staging token below.

portal login ticket: eyJhbGciOiJIUzI1NiIsInR5cCI6IkpXVCJ9.eyJzdWIiOiIwEOsktwVNwIn0.-UJU3fdyyCgG

## Request Tracing: Who Owns What

If your review touches trace propagation in the Harborline mesh, the Spindletrace team owns header conventions and sampling policy; individual service teams own span naming within their code. Changes to the propagation middleware require a Spindletrace approver — don't merge without one. Context-loss bugs across async boundaries are theirs too. For approver availability or convention questions, contact the tracing maintainers.

escalation mailbox, bafog-fafog: ulador@paliqlabs.internal

# Retry configuration for failed exports — Dunmore report service.
# EXPORT_RETRY_MAX (default 4) bounds attempts; backoff doubles from
# EXPORT_RETRY_BASE_MS with jitter to avoid thundering the warehouse.
# Exhausted jobs land on the dead-letter queue and page the owning team.
# Reviewers: confirm retries stay idempotent — the export marker table
# prevents duplicate files. The dead-letter queue needs authenticated
# access, so the line below must be present.

secret setting of yajog-taguf: ARCHIVE_KEY3=051